LBO France and Abenex have signed an exclusive agreement aimed at the acquisition by LBO France of the majority stake in RG Safety Group currently held by Abenex.
Founded in 1987, headquartered in Saint Priest, and now managed by Pierre Manchini (CEO), RG Safety Group is the French leading specialised distributor of Personal Protective Equipment (PPE). The group distributes a wide range of products (35,000 references) covering 6 main protection fields: Head, Hand, Foot, Body, Breathing, and Hygiene & Safety in the working environment. Monroe Capital has acted as sole lead arranger and administrative agent on the funding of a USD25 million asset-based facility to refinance the existing debt facility and provide working capital for Betteridge Jewelers (Betteridge).
Founded in 1897 and based in Greenwich, Connecticut, Betteridge is a premier jeweller and watch retailer selling many of the world’s most luxurious brands.
The company operates stores in Greenwich, Connecticut; Palm Beach, Florida; Vail, Colorado; and Aspen, Colorado.

Private Advisors has closed its oversubscribed seventh small company private equity fund (Fund VII) at its hard cap of USD350 million.
Fund VII focuses exclusively on the small company market in North America where Private Advisors has been a leading investor for more than 20 years. The Fund primarily invests in lower-middle market buyout, growth and distressed private equity funds (typically less than USD750 million in size), along with targeted equity co-investments and opportunistic secondary investments.
